The Importance Of Data Governance In Ensuring Data Security

In today’s digital world, data has become one of the most valuable assets for organizations With the increasing emphasis on data-driven decision-making, businesses are collecting and storing vast amounts of data to stay ahead of the competition However, the more data an organization collects, the greater the risks of data breaches and unauthorized access This is where data governance plays a crucial role in ensuring data security.

Data governance is the process of managing the availability, usability, integrity, and security of an organization’s data It involves establishing policies, procedures, and controls to ensure that data is accurate, reliable, and secure Data governance also encompasses the people, processes, and technologies that are involved in managing and protecting data assets.

One of the key aspects of data governance is data security Data security refers to the measures taken to protect data from unauthorized access, disclosure, alteration, or destruction It is essential for organizations to implement robust data security measures to safeguard their sensitive information from cyber threats and malicious actors.

Data governance and data security are closely intertwined, with data governance providing the framework for establishing data security policies and practices By implementing effective data governance practices, organizations can enhance their data security posture and reduce the risks of data breaches and cyber attacks.

There are several ways in which data governance can help ensure data security Firstly, data governance helps organizations identify and classify their data assets based on their sensitivity and importance By categorizing data according to its level of confidentiality, organizations can determine the appropriate security controls to be implemented to protect the data.

By setting up role-based access controls, organizations can limit access to sensitive data to only authorized personnel, reducing the risks of unauthorized access and data breaches.

Furthermore, data governance ensures data quality and integrity by establishing data management policies and standards By maintaining data accuracy and consistency, organizations can prevent data corruption and manipulation, which can compromise data security.

Another key aspect of data governance is data privacy With the increasing regulations around data privacy,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A), organizations need to ensure that they are compliant with data privacy laws and regulations Data governance helps organizations implement privacy controls and measures to protect personal data and uphold individuals’ privacy rights.
